User: d_jencks
  Date: 01/11/12 10:35:17

  Modified:    src/main/org/jboss/resource/connectionmanager
                        PoolManager.java
  Log:
  Updated the manual to show mbean refs: simplified the pool configuration.  The pool 
changes are a bit of a hack, but do expose what I think is a better interface.  
Blocking is always on, idle timeout is always on. Idle timeout and CleanupInterval are 
in minutes.
  
  Revision  Changes    Path
  1.2       +7 -7      
jbosscx/src/main/org/jboss/resource/connectionmanager/PoolManager.java
  
  Index: PoolManager.java
  ===================================================================
  RCS file: 
/cvsroot/jboss/jbosscx/src/main/org/jboss/resource/connectionmanager/PoolManager.java,v
  retrieving revision 1.1
  retrieving revision 1.2
  diff -u -r1.1 -r1.2
  --- PoolManager.java  2001/09/08 19:32:21     1.1
  +++ PoolManager.java  2001/11/12 18:35:17     1.2
  @@ -27,19 +27,19 @@
      private static ObjectPool createPool(PoolObjectFactory factory, PoolParameters 
params, String name)
      {
         ObjectPool pool = new ObjectPool(factory, name);
  -      pool.setBlocking(params.blocking);
  +      //pool.setBlocking(params.blocking);
         pool.setBlockingTimeout(params.blockingTimeoutMillis);
  -      pool.setGCEnabled(params.gcEnabled);
  -      pool.setGCInterval(params.gcIntervalMillis);
  -      pool.setGCMinIdleTime(params.gcMinIdleMillis);
  +      //pool.setGCEnabled(params.gcEnabled);
  +      pool.setCleanupInterval(params.cleanupIntervalMillis);
  +      //pool.setGCMinIdleTime(params.gcMinIdleMillis);
         pool.setIdleTimeout(params.idleTimeoutMillis);
  -      pool.setIdleTimeoutEnabled(params.idleTimeoutEnabled);
  -      pool.setInvalidateOnError(params.invalidateOnError);
  +      //pool.setIdleTimeoutEnabled(params.idleTimeoutEnabled);
  +      // pool.setInvalidateOnError(params.invalidateOnError);
         //pool.setLogWriter(params.logger);
         pool.setMaxIdleTimeoutPercent(params.maxIdleTimeoutPercent);
         pool.setMaxSize(params.maxSize);
         pool.setMinSize(params.minSize);
  -      pool.setTimestampUsed(params.trackLastUsed);
  +      //pool.setTimestampUsed(params.trackLastUsed);
         pool.initialize();
         return pool;
      }
  
  
  

_______________________________________________
Jboss-development mailing list
[EMAIL PROTECTED]
https://lists.sourceforge.net/lists/listinfo/jboss-development

Reply via email to